What is the Main difference between professional and residential dryers?
In a significant degree, it will come down to potential, sturdiness, velocity and electricity supply.
Residential dryers are crafted for reasonable, cease-start house use. Commercial dryers are engineered for consistent Procedure, heavier loads and speedier turnaround instances.
In accordance with the U.S. Division of Power, dryers are amongst the highest energy-consuming appliances inside of a house. Now imagine that multiplied across dozens of daily loads in a company environment — that’s why industrial models are created differently.

Why are business dryers a great deal of costlier?
Given that they’re created like workhorses.
Commercial machines use:
Reinforced drum bearings
Industrial motors
Better BTU fuel burners
State-of-the-art airflow methods
Programmable Management panels
They’re created to lower downtime. In business, downtime equals dropped profits. In the home, it’s just an inconvenience.

Do business dryers truly dry faster?
Indeed — and this is where many people undervalue the difference.
Industrial dryers move a lot more air at higher temperatures. Quicker airflow equals faster moisture removal. It’s physics, not promoting.
That speed issues if you:
Run an Airbnb with rapid changeovers
Handle a childcare centre
Operate a hair salon with frequent towel loads
Personal a laundromat
For households doing two or 3 hundreds over a Sunday afternoon? Enough time preserving may not justify the expense.
Can you employ a business dryer in your own home?
Technically, Certainly. Basically, it depends.
Items to consider:
Some need three-stage electrical power (typical in business buildings, uncommon in houses)
Air flow prerequisites are stricter
Sound stages are increased
They’re physically greater and heavier

Are business dryers louder?
Certainly. laundry machine space planning They prioritise airflow and ability about silent Procedure. Expect far more sound as compared to household models.
Do commercial dryers need to have Exclusive set up?
Frequently Of course. Lots of require higher voltage, fuel connections, reinforced venting and Expert set up.
Is really a professional dryer worth it for a big loved ones?
Almost never. Even massive households generally don’t create the everyday load volume needed to justify the cost.
